An expanding, locally based Quantity Surveying consultancy are seeking an eager to learn Graduate Quantity Surveyor to join their Berkshire office.
The Graduate Quantity Surveyor's role
The successful Graduate Quantity Surveyor will join a close-knit QS team and assist on an array of projects including hotels, student accommodation, and cladding remediation.
Day to day, the new Graduate Quantity Surveyor will have the opportunity to carry out pre and post contract tasks as well as attending site, and beginning your APC training.
The Graduate Quantity Surveyor
Completed or in the final stages of completing a Quantity Surveying degree Basked in Berkshire/Buckinghamshire area Driving licence and car Quantity Surveying work experience would be a plus Eager to achieve MRICS Hard working, proactive, politeIn Return?
£25,000 - £30,000 25 days annual leave + bank holidays Christmas shutdown Pension APC support Professional membership fee Flexible working Sociable working environmentIf you are a Quantity Surveyor considering your career opportunities, please contact Daniel Foster at Foster & May.
